php源码的安装方法和实例

 更新时间:2019年09月26日 15:33:02   作者:爱喝马黛茶的安东尼  
在本篇文章里小编给大家整理的是关于php源码怎么安装的相关知识点内容,有需要的读者们学习下。

在官网下载源码包:https://www.php.net/downloads.php

步骤:

1、解压

命令:tar -xjvf php.tar.bz2

2、configure

configure工具是一个shell脚本,在配置编译前需要gcc、autoconfig工具。

可以通过./configure --help 查看配置参数

进入解压后的php目录,编译源码:

./configure --prefix=/home/php (--prefix指定安装php路径)

3、make

执行编译构建命令:make

4、make install

执行编译构建命令:make install

需要注意:执行命令:php -i | grep php.ini 查看php执行的php.ini路径,复制配置文件php.ini文件到该目录,否则加载配置文件失败

PHP命令:

  • php -m 查看php扩展
  • php -v 查看版本
  • php --ini 查看php.ini路径
  • php --ri swoole 查看swoole扩展是否成功
  • mac pro 配置php环境变量
  • vim ~/.bash_profile
  • 加入:alias php=/home/php/bin/php 保存
  • source ~/.bash_profile

以上就是php源码怎么安装的详细内容,更多请关注脚本之家其它相关文章!

相关文章

  • 浅析PHP页面局部刷新功能的实现小结

    浅析PHP页面局部刷新功能的实现小结

    本篇文章是对PHP页面局部刷新功能的实现进行了详细的分析介绍,需要的朋友参考下
    2013-06-06
  • PHP创建简单RPC服务案例详解

    PHP创建简单RPC服务案例详解

    这篇文章主要介绍了PHP创建简单RPC服务案例详解,本篇文章通过简要的案例,讲解了该项技术的了解与使用,以下就是详细内容,需要的朋友可以参考下
    2021-09-09
  • php数据访问之增删改查操作

    php数据访问之增删改查操作

    这篇文章主要为大家详细介绍了php数据访问之增删改查操作的相关资料,感兴趣的小伙伴们可以参考一下
    2016-05-05
  • php zend解密软件绿色版测试可用

    php zend解密软件绿色版测试可用

    今天有个同事给我个在线的可以解密zend加密的网页,不过没有本地软件更方便,所以找到了一个绿色版zend解密工具,php学习人员必备小工具
    2008-04-04
  • php实现html标签闭合检测与修复方法

    php实现html标签闭合检测与修复方法

    这篇文章主要介绍了php实现html标签闭合检测与修复方法,可实现针对html标签中结束标签的检测与补全功能,非常具有实用价值,需要的朋友可以参考下
    2015-07-07
  • PHP面向对象分析设计的61条军规小结

    PHP面向对象分析设计的61条军规小结

    你不必严格遵守这些原则,违背它们也不会被处以宗教刑罚。但你应当把这些原则看成警铃,若违背了其中的一条,那么警铃就会响起 。
    2010-07-07
  • php redis的scan用法实例分析

    php redis的scan用法实例分析

    在本篇文章了小编给大家整理了一篇关于php redis的scan用法实例分析内容,有兴趣的朋友们可以跟着学习下。
    2021-12-12
  • php通用防注入程序 推荐

    php通用防注入程序 推荐

    今天做完了整个php项目,想来安全问题不少,开发程序的过程中无心过滤参数。所以注入少不了,才有了下面的防注入程序.
    2011-02-02
  • php一个解析字符串排列数组的方法

    php一个解析字符串排列数组的方法

    这篇文章主要介绍了php一个解析字符串排列数组的方法,可实现字符串的拆分与排列功能,具有一定参考借鉴价值,需要的朋友可以参考下
    2015-05-05
  • PHP获取ip对应地区和使用网络类型的方法

    PHP获取ip对应地区和使用网络类型的方法

    这篇文章主要介绍了PHP获取ip对应地区和使用网络类型的方法,实例分析了php通过调用ip138数据库获取IP及网络类型的技巧,需要的朋友可以参考下
    2015-03-03

最新评论